Note: Pressure values in Table 5 are approximate values. Use a pressure sensor for adjustment.
Note: A continuous relief of the valve for more than 10 seconds is not allowed.
- Position the machine on level ground.
- Stop the engine.
- Release the pressure in the hydraulic system. Refer to Testing and Adjusting, "Hydraulic System Pressure - Release".
- Connect a
41,368 kPa (6,000 psi) pressure sensor to pressure tap (1). - Start the engine.
- Place the machine controls at the following settings: engine speed dial "10" and AEC switch OFF. Refer to Testing and Adjusting, "Engine Performance - Test (Engine Speed)" for engine rpm settings.
- Place the hydraulic activation control lever in the UNLOCKED position.
- Increase the hydraulic oil temperature to
55° ± 5°C (131° ± 9°F) . - Slowly move the blade control lever to the full RAISE position and check the pressure reading at pressure tap (1). Refer to Table 1 for the specification.
- Return the blade control lever to the NEUTRAL position.
- If the setting of the blade main relief valve is not within the specification, adjust the relief valve. Refer to adjustment procedure "Blade Main Relief Valve".
Temporary Setting of the Main Relief Valve
Note: A temporary setting of the main relief valve is required before any line relief valves can be adjusted.
- Connect a
41,368 kPa (6,000 psi) pressure sensor to pressure tap (1). - Perform the following steps to make a temporary adjustment to the blade main relief valve.
- Move the blade control lever until the blade is at the full RAISE position (full retraction of the blade cylinder). Hold the blade control lever in this position.
- Check the pressure setting of the blade main relief valve at pressure tap (1).
- Return the blade control lever to the NEUTRAL position.

Illustration 4 g03722285 Blade control valve (main relief)
(2) Blade main relief valve
(4) Locknut
(5) Adjustment screw - Loosen locknut (4) on blade main relief valve (2). Turn adjustment screw (5) until the pressure reading at pressure tap (1) is
27500 kPa (4000 psi) .Note: Turning adjustment screw (5) clockwise increases the pressure. Turning adjustment screw (5) counterclockwise decreases the pressure.
Note: Always make final pressure adjustment on pressure rise.
- Tighten locknut (4).
- Reset main relief valve pressure setting to the normal operating condition after the completion of the line relief test and adjust.
Note: A temporary setting of the blade main relief valve is required before the blade line relief valve is adjusted. Refer to "Temporary Setting of the Main Relief Valve".
Note: Refer to Testing and Adjusting, "Specifications" for the pressure setting of the blade relief valves.
- Connect a
41,368 kPa (6,000 psi) pressure sensor to pressure tap (1). - To check the pressure setting of the blade line relief valve, move the blade control lever to the full LOWER position (full extension of the blade cylinder). Hold the blade control lever in this position.
- Check the line relief valve pressure setting of the blade cylinder at pressure tap (1).
- Return the blade control lever to the NEUTRAL position.
- If the setting of the blade line relief valve is not within the specification, adjust the relief valve. Refer to adjustment procedure "Blade Line Relief Valve".
- Return the pressure setting of the blade main relief valve to specification after adjusting the blade line relief valve. Refer to Table 2 for the pressure setting of the blade main relief valve.
- If the setting of the blade main relief valve is not within the specification, adjust the relief valve. Refer to Table 1 for the specification.

Illustration 5 g03722285 Blade control valve (main relief)
(2) Blade main relief valve
(4) Locknut
(5) Adjustment screw - To adjust blade main relief valve (2), loosen locknut (4) on the blade main relief valve (2). Turn adjustment screw (5) until the pressure reading at pressure tap (1) is within the specification . Refer to Table 1.
Note: Turning adjustment screw (5) clockwise increases the pressure. Turning adjustment screw (5) counterclockwise decreases the pressure.
Note: Always make final pressure adjustment on pressure rise.
- Tighten locknut (4).
Note: A temporary setting of the blade main relief valve is required before the blade line relief valve is adjusted. Refer to "Temporary Setting of the Main Relief Valve".
- If the setting of the blade line relief valve is not within the specification, adjust the relief valve. Refer to Table 2 for the specification.
Show/hide table
Illustration 6 g03722288 Blade control valve (line relief)
(3) Blade line relief valve
(6) Locknut
(7) Adjustment screw - To adjust blade line relief valve, loosen locknut (6) on the blade line relief valve (3). Turn adjustment screw (7) until the pressure reading at pressure tap (1) is within the specification. Refer to Table 2.
Note: Turning adjustment screw (7) clockwise increases the pressure. Turning adjustment screw (7) counterclockwise decreases the pressure.
Note: Always make final pressure adjustment on pressure rise.
- Tighten locknut (6).
- Return the pressure setting of the blade main relief valve to specification after adjusting the blade line relief valve. Refer to Table 1 for the pressure setting of the blade main relief valve.
